Where is Gairloch Sands Youth Hostel?

Where is Gairloch Sands Youth Hostel located?

Gairloch Sands Youth Hostel, Gairloch Sands Youth Hostel, Great Britain (approx. 57.7323°, -5.75953°)


Where is Gairloch Sands Youth Hostel on the map?